What to look for:
Protest: · Ads with a message or image intended to make people feel bad about their body shape or size. · Promoting thinness as
only acceptable body size. · Shows or ads that make fun of heavy people or imply that they are inferior or unacceptable. · Idealizing people who are dieting or starving themselves. · People shown using food for comfort, stress relief, or companionship. · Emaciated models or actresses portrayed as
beauty ideal or star of
program. · Promoting fitness and exercise solely as ways to get thin rather than ways to get healthy, feel good, and have fun.
Praise: · Ads that have people of all sizes and shapes depicted in positive ways. · People eating healthy, good foods including desserts. · Celebration of natural diversity and
enjoyment of life.
